This Will Make You Cringe

Snowmobile Ultimate Crash Compilation

Published online: May 06, 2013 News
Viewed 257 time(s)
So if you have a bit of a weak stomach or don't like to watch sleds crash ... skip this and don't watch it. This will most likely make you cringe.

Having said that, a couple of the crashes are pretty funny, some are scary and some are, well, what in the sam hill were they thinking?

